Understanding Cat Collar Safety Features

The most critical aspect of any cat collar is its safety design. Breakaway collars have revolutionized feline safety by automatically releasing when caught on objects, preventing choking or injury. The American Veterinary Medical Association strongly recommends breakaway collars for outdoor cats, as they significantly reduce the risk of collar-related accidents.

Traditional non-breakaway collars pose serious risks. Cats are natural climbers and explorers, often squeezing through tight spaces where collars can become caught. A properly functioning breakaway mechanism should activate with 4-6 pounds of pressure – enough to hold during normal activity but release during emergencies.

Bell attachments serve dual purposes: they alert birds and small prey to your cat's presence, reducing hunting success, and help you locate your cat around the house. However, some cats find bells irritating initially. Gradual introduction over several days typically resolves this issue.

Sizing and Fit Considerations

Proper collar sizing is crucial for both comfort and safety. A correctly fitted cat collar should allow two fingers to slide comfortably underneath when secured around your cat's neck. Too tight restricts breathing and causes discomfort; too loose increases snagging risk and reduces identification effectiveness.

Most cats have neck circumferences between 8-12 inches, but individual variation exists. Measure your cat's neck with a soft measuring tape, adding 1-2 inches for comfort. Adjustable collars offer flexibility as cats grow or gain weight seasonally.

Kitten collars require special attention as rapid growth necessitates frequent size adjustments. Check collar fit weekly during the first year, ensuring proper looseness as your kitten develops.

Material Selection and Durability

Collar materials significantly impact comfort, durability, and maintenance requirements. Cotton offers natural breathability and softness but requires more frequent washing and may absorb odors more readily. Nylon provides excellent durability and water resistance while maintaining flexibility.

Leather collars offer classic appearance and long-term durability but require specific care to maintain suppleness. Some cats develop sensitivities to certain materials, making hypoallergenic options important for sensitive pets.

Hardware quality affects both safety and longevity. Breakaway buckles should operate smoothly without sticking or premature release. Bell attachments and D-rings for tags should resist corrosion and maintain secure connections.

Training Your Cat to Accept Collars

Many cats initially resist wearing collars, but patient introduction usually succeeds. Start by allowing your cat to investigate the collar, rewarding positive interactions with treats or praise. This builds positive associations before actual wearing begins.

First fitting should last only a few minutes, gradually increasing duration over several days. Distraction with play or treats during initial wearing sessions reduces focus on the collar's presence. Never force collar acceptance; instead, work at your cat's pace to build comfort gradually.

Some cats adapt within hours, while others require weeks of gradual conditioning. Persistence and positive reinforcement typically overcome initial resistance. If your cat continues struggling after extended introduction periods, consult your veterinarian about alternatives or techniques.

Maintenance and Care Guidelines

Regular collar maintenance ensures continued safety and comfort. Inspect breakaway mechanisms monthly, testing release function by applying gentle pressure. Clean collars weekly using pet-safe detergents, paying special attention to areas that contact your cat's skin.

Replace collars showing signs of wear, fraying, or mechanism failure immediately. Even high-quality collars have limited lifespans due to daily stress and environmental exposure. Keep backup collars available to avoid gaps in identification and safety protection.

Tag information should remain current and legible. Replace worn identification tags promptly, ensuring contact information reflects current phone numbers and addresses. Consider microchipping as permanent backup identification that doesn't rely on collar retention.

Store spare collars in clean, dry conditions to maintain material integrity. Rotate between multiple collars to extend overall lifespan and provide variety for fashion-conscious cat owners.

Frequently Asked Questions About cat collar

Are breakaway cat collars really necessary for indoor cats?

Yes, breakaway collars are recommended for all cats, including indoor-only cats. Cats can get collars caught on furniture, door handles, or other household items. The breakaway mechanism prevents choking or injury if the collar becomes snagged during play or exploration around the house.

How often should I replace my cat's collar?

Cat collars should be replaced every 6-12 months or sooner if they show signs of wear, fraying, or if the breakaway mechanism stops working properly. Regular inspection is important to ensure continued safety and effectiveness of the collar's safety features.

Can kittens wear the same collars as adult cats?

Kittens need specially sized collars designed for their smaller necks and rapid growth. Most adult cat collars are too large and heavy for kittens. Look for adjustable kitten collars and check the fit weekly as they grow quickly during their first year.

What should I do if my cat refuses to wear a collar?

Start with gradual introduction by letting your cat investigate the collar first, then wear it for just a few minutes daily while providing treats or playtime as distraction. Gradually increase wearing time over several days to weeks. Be patient and never force the process, as some cats need more time to adjust.

Are reflective collars worth the extra cost?

Reflective collars are highly recommended, especially for cats that go outdoors or may escape. The enhanced visibility during low-light conditions significantly improves safety by making cats more visible to vehicles and helping owners locate them. The small additional cost is worthwhile for the safety benefits.

Should I remove my cat's collar at night?

No, cats should wear their collars continuously unless there's a specific medical reason to remove them. Modern breakaway collars are designed for 24/7 wear and provide important identification if your cat escapes during nighttime hours. Consistent wearing also helps cats stay accustomed to the collar.

Do bells on cat collars actually protect wildlife?

Yes, studies show that bells on cat collars can reduce bird catches by 30-50% and small mammal catches by about 40%. While not 100% effective, bells give prey animals advance warning of a cat's approach, significantly reducing successful hunting attempts and helping protect local wildlife populations.

How to Choose the Best cat collar

Follow these expert steps to select the perfect cat collar for your cat:

Step 1: Measure Your Cat's Neck Properly

Use a soft measuring tape to measure around your cat's neck where the collar will sit, typically just below the ears. Add 1-2 inches to this measurement for comfort. The collar should allow two fingers to fit comfortably underneath when fastened.

Step 2: Choose the Right Collar Type

Select a breakaway collar appropriate for your cat's lifestyle. For indoor cats, prioritize comfort materials like cotton. For outdoor cats, choose durable, weather-resistant materials like nylon with reflective elements for visibility.

Step 3: Test the Breakaway Mechanism

Before putting the collar on your cat, test the breakaway mechanism by pulling gently on opposite ends. The collar should release with 4-6 pounds of pressure. If it's too easy or difficult to release, adjust the mechanism or choose a different collar.

Step 4: Introduce the Collar Gradually

Let your cat investigate the collar first, then put it on for just 5-10 minutes while providing treats or engaging in play. Gradually increase wearing time over several days until your cat is comfortable wearing it continuously.

Step 5: Attach Identification Tags Securely

Add ID tags with your current contact information, ensuring they're securely attached to the D-ring. Include your phone number and address, and consider adding 'indoor cat' if applicable to alert finders that your cat isn't accustomed to being outside.

Step 6: Monitor and Maintain Regularly

Check the collar fit weekly, especially for growing cats. Inspect the breakaway mechanism monthly and clean the collar regularly with pet-safe products. Replace immediately if you notice any wear, fraying, or mechanism failure.

Step 7: Keep Backup Collars Ready

Maintain spare collars with up-to-date ID tags in case the primary collar is lost or needs replacement. This ensures your cat is never without proper identification and safety protection.
